WASHINGTON, Nov. 18 -- Rep. Elaine Luria, D-Virginia, issued the following news release:
Rep. Elaine Luria's (D-VA) Ensuring Phone and Internet Access Through Lifeline and Affordable Connectivity Act of 2021 (H.R. 4275) passed the House of Representatives on Monday. The bipartisan bill would help more Americans afford crucial phone and internet service by providing transparency into enrollment of these programs and examining effectiveness of outreach for the programs.
